The utility model discloses a maintenance construction platform for power distribution network construction, which comprises a base, a motor room is fixed on the top of the base by bolts, a motor is fixed on the inner wall of the bottom of the motor room by bolts, and one end of the output shaft of the motor is welded with a motor room. Two screw rods, one end of the second screw rod is sleeved with a threaded sleeve, one outer wall of the threaded sleeve is welded with a connecting frame, one end of the connecting frame is rotatably connected with a roller, a guide rod is welded on the top of the base, and one end of the guide rod is A spring is sleeved, and the other end of the guide rod is sleeved with a sleeve, and one end of the sleeve is fixedly connected with one end of the spring. The utility model can avoid the occurrence of the overturning phenomenon of the maintenance construction platform caused by the slippage of the tire, improve the safety of the maintenance construction platform, and can also adjust the height of the device while standing on the maintenance construction platform, so that the device is more flexible. Easy to operate, and the folding ladder is designed to allow operators to get on and off the platform easily.

本实施例的工作原理:当电机4启动,电机4输出轴开始转动,从而带动第二丝杆19转动,第二丝杆19的转动,使得螺纹套筒18在第二丝杆19上垂直上升,从而带动连接架上升,连接架的上升带动滚轮1向上移动,从而将滚轮收进装置内部,使得底座直接与地面接触,以防滚轮打滑,转动摇把12,摇把12的转动带动第二齿轮9旋转,第二齿轮9的旋转带动第一齿轮8一起旋转,从而使得第一丝杆17转动,第一丝杆17的转动使得套环在第一丝杆17上水平移动,套环的移动使得连接杆7在滑槽上滑动,从而使得伸缩架16收缩或扩张,来调节装置的高度。The working principle of this embodiment: when the motor 4 starts, the output shaft of the motor 4 starts to rotate, thereby driving the second screw rod 19 to rotate, and the rotation of the second screw rod 19 makes the threaded sleeve 18 vertically rise on the second screw rod 19 , thereby driving the connecting frame to rise, and the rising of the connecting frame drives the roller 1 to move upward, so that the roller is retracted into the device, so that the base directly contacts the ground to prevent the roller from slipping, and the crank handle 12 is rotated. The gear 9 rotates, and the rotation of the second gear 9 drives the first gear 8 to rotate together, so that the first screw rod 17 rotates, and the rotation of the first screw rod 17 causes the collar to move horizontally on the first screw rod 17. The movement causes the connecting rod 7 to slide on the chute, thereby causing the telescopic frame 16 to contract or expand to adjust the height of the device.
